Round | Body Matrix Categories
Round body types have some softness to their bone structure. They appear curvy, rounded and circular throughout their figure. This is my guide for if you might be in the round category and how to dress for this feature

Features
Roundness appears in the bone structure. To be rounded means you have soft, round shapes in your frame. You might appear traditionally curvy or “hourglass”. have rounded shapes to your shoulders, chest and hips. You can be round or straight at any weight. These are some features to look out for:
rounded chest and hips
full chest and hips (for your proportions)
rounded shoulders
defined waist (but not always indented)
soft flesh at any weight (not hard or taut)
hourglass silhouette (but not necessarily)

How to Style
You don’t have to include ALL of the following elements in an outfit to honour your round shape, but one to three details will help to create this impression. There are also lots of other elements I could include, but I think this is a good starting point!
Waist definition
Defining the smallest point of your waist through a garment which is fitted to come inwards at the waist is the best way to highlight your rounded frame. Even if you don’t have a “small” or “indented” waist, if you have a rounded frame, waist definition will feel completely natural for you. You want to highlight the smallest point of your waist, which typically if you are rounded will be your mid-torso rather than under the bust or just above the hips. This can include a wrap dress, a belted waist, ruched waist and you might avoid an empire waist, dropped waist or obscured waist.
Soft fabrics
The main aim of the fabrics you put on your body is to echo the shapes of your body - to be an extension of the soft, round lines in your frame. You can do this in two ways: firstly, by wearing soft, floaty fabrics and secondly by wearing clingy fabrics which cling to your chest and hips. Avoid fabrics which are stiff, structured, and hard to mould around your curves. The fabrics you wear should be moveable.
Round shapes
Your outfit should be a collection of curved shapes. Whether its a round neckline, rounded sleeves, rounded trouser leg, rounded toes, round chest and hips, your outfit should be moving in a constant shape of curves rather than stiff, sharp lines.
Openness
Those with softness generally benefit from openness somewhere. This could be an open neckline, an open sleeve, open skirt, open leg - generally this helps to echo the shapes of the hourglass throughout the outfit, recreating that ‘in and out’ silhouette. Those with, say, narrowness need to then find a balance between open and narrow e.g. you might wear a halter neck which is close near the neck but open at the chest, or wear a tight, clingy top with a closed neckline so you are honouring the curve in a different way.
